Output 7e68c78c439c79b89cf4e824e81c171f890551dab4810ee305869838c0aef30f:18

value
2848314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628dcc38ee8d5912ae27fd0e3d37bb4b3f9017b6 OP_EQUAL
address
3Ag81d6L15z7TPZt6DEuGVVCpDCmqQcLer
transaction
7e68c78c439c79b89cf4e824e81c171f890551dab4810ee305869838c0aef30f
spent
true